Sausage from nearby Le Locle, traditionally poached and often served with potato salad. It is a celebrated specialty of the Neuchâtel Jura.
Slow-cooked pork and cabbage dish from the Neuchâtel region, valued as a hearty Jura meal tied to local winter cooking traditions.
Absinthe from the Val-de-Travers, a short trip away. This iconic anise spirit is one of the region’s most famous historic drinks.

Very expensive for most travelers. Hotels, restaurant meals, and everyday shopping cost more than in much of Europe, though local transit is efficient and predictable.
Service is usually included. Round up or leave 5-10% for great service. Taxis are commonly rounded up, and small change is fine in cafes.
